    security.declareProtected(ManagePortal, 'getLatestUpgradeStep')
    def getLatestUpgradeStep(self, profile_id):
        '''
        Get the highest ordered upgrade step available to
        a specific profile.

        If anything errors out then go back to "old way"
        by returning 'unknown'
        '''
        setup = getToolByName(self, 'portal_setup')
        profile_version = 'unknown'
        try:
            available = setup.listUpgrades(profile_id, True)
            if available:  # could return empty sequence
                latest = available[-1]
                profile_version = max(latest['dest'],
                        key=pkg_resources.parse_version)
        except Exception:
            pass

        return profile_version
